使用Hermes Agent与Claude Code构建AI协同开发团队:架构、部署与实战指南

简介: 在AI驱动开发的新时代,单一AI工具已难以满足全流程研发需求。Hermes Agent作为具备自进化、长记忆、任务调度能力的智能主控,搭配Claude Code强大的代码生成、调试、测试与闭环执行能力,可形成一套类似“技术主管+资深开发工程师”的协同工作模式。前者负责需求理解、任务拆解、流程调度、经验沉淀与交互确认,后者专注高质量编码、程序调试与逻辑实现,二者结合真正实现从需求到代码的端到端闭环。

一、前言

在AI驱动开发的新时代,单一AI工具已难以满足全流程研发需求。Hermes Agent作为具备自进化、长记忆、任务调度能力的智能主控,搭配Claude Code强大的代码生成、调试、测试与闭环执行能力,可形成一套类似“技术主管+资深开发工程师”的协同工作模式。前者负责需求理解、任务拆解、流程调度、经验沉淀与交互确认,后者专注高质量编码、程序调试与逻辑实现,二者结合真正实现从需求到代码的端到端闭环。

阿里云提供基于云开发机DevBox的一键部署能力,让用户无需配置复杂环境,即可快速搭建Hermes Agent与Claude Code协同运行环境,接入平台模型服务,稳定、高效地开展自动化开发工作。本文将完整解析双AI协同架构、核心价值、部署流程、配置方法与实际使用方式,帮助个人与团队快速落地AI开发团队。

二、Hermes Agent与Claude Code协同架构解析

(一)Hermes Agent:团队主控与智能协调者

Hermes Agent并非普通对话机器人,而是具备完整自我进化能力的AI智能体。它拥有跨会话持久记忆、行为学习、经验提炼、技能沉淀能力,能够记住用户的代码风格、项目规范、沟通习惯,并在每次任务后自动总结方案、问题、解决方案,生成可复用技能,使系统越用越高效。阿里云部署 OpenClaw/Hermes Agent全网最简单,只需两步,详情👉访问阿里云OpenClaw/Hermes一键部署专题页面 了解。
OpenClaw1.png
OpenClaw2.png
OpenClaw02.png
openClaw3.png
OpenClaw031.png
OpenClaw03.png
OpenClaw04.png
OpenClaw5.png
Openclaw6.png
👉访问订阅阿里云百炼Token Plan AI大模型服务 。支持多模型切换,用于多模态模型灵活调用,实现多模型、多工具、多场景下的额度共享与统一管理,兼顾灵活性、稳定性与安全性,大幅降低企业使用大模型的门槛与成本。
tokenplan1.png
tokenplan1.png
tokenplan2.png
tokenplan3.png
tokenplan4.png

在协同架构中,Hermes Agent承担技术主管角色:

  1. 接收并理解用户开发需求
  2. 联合Claude Code进行方案设计与可行性评估
  3. 向用户确认方案并根据反馈迭代调整
  4. 将任务拆解为编码单元并分发给Claude Code
  5. 对代码结果进行整合、校验与反馈
  6. 记录整个流程经验,实现系统自我进化

它是整个团队的调度中枢、交互入口与记忆载体。

(二)Claude Code:编码专家与执行单元

Claude Code是专注于代码领域的专业AI工具,具备极强的代码理解、生成、重构、调试与测试能力,支持完整开发流程执行。在协同架构中,它作为资深开发工程师,负责接收Hermes Agent下发的编码任务,高效输出高质量代码,并完成初步调试与验证。

其核心价值体现在:

  1. 快速实现业务逻辑与功能代码
  2. 自动生成配套测试用例
  3. 对代码进行自检、纠错与优化
  4. 按照项目规范输出标准化代码
  5. 支持复杂项目的多文件协同开发

三、双AI协同的完整工作流程

1. 任务接收与方案设计

用户向Hermes Agent下达开发需求,Hermes对需求进行分析拆解,并联合Claude Code共同制定技术方案、模块划分、实现步骤与风险点。

2. 方案确认与迭代

Hermes将设计方案整理后呈现给用户,用户可提出修改意见,双AI组合自动调整方案,直到方向完全符合预期。这一过程保证开发透明、可控。

3. 编码执行与调试

方案确认后,Hermes按模块分发编码任务给Claude Code。Claude Code完成代码编写、基础调试、自测后,将结果回传Hermes进行整合。

4. 结果交付与反馈

Hermes对代码进行汇总、格式校验、逻辑核对后交付用户。若需修改,则继续迭代优化。

5. 经验沉淀与自我进化

任务完成后,Hermes自动记录关键方案、问题、解决方案、优化思路,生成可复用技能。未来同类任务可直接使用历史经验,大幅提升效率与稳定性。

这种模式将AI从一次性工具,升级为可长期成长、持续适配团队习惯的数字开发团队

四、基于阿里云DevBox一键部署流程

阿里云云开发机DevBox提供预装环境,用户可一键部署Hermes Agent + Claude Code协同环境,无需手动配置依赖。

步骤1:进入控制台创建应用

  1. 登录阿里云ECS控制台
  2. 进入左侧“应用管理”
  3. 选择“通过模板创建”
  4. 在模板市场中找到“云开发机DevBox”并部署

步骤2:选择AI协同环境

在开发环境选项中,进入“AI编码助手”分类,选择:
Hermes + Claude Code
系统已预装两大工具及其依赖环境。

步骤3:配置实例参数

支持新建ECS或使用已有ECS,付费模式支持按量付费与包年包月。选择合适配置后进入订单确认,系统自动开始部署。

步骤4:获取远程连接信息

部署完成后,控制台会提供SSH链接与远程IDE访问地址,支持VSCode、Qoder等工具直接连接。

五、环境配置与API接入(关键步骤)

远程连接进入DevBox后,在终端中执行以下配置,完成模型服务接入。

(1)配置Claude Code

创建配置文件夹并编辑配置文件:

sudo mkdir -p /etc/claude-code
sudo vim /etc/claude-code/managed-settings.json

i进入编辑模式,填入以下内容(将YOUR_API_KEY替换为自己的API密钥):

{
   
  "env": {
   
    "ANTHROPIC_AUTH_TOKEN": "YOUR_API_KEY",
    "ANTHROPIC_BASE_URL": "https://dashscope.aliyuncs.com/apps/anthropic",
    "ANTHROPIC_MODEL": "qwen3.6-plus"
  }
}

ESC,输入:wq保存退出。

(2)配置Hermes Agent环境变量

echo 'DASHSCOPE_API_KEY=YOUR_API_KEY' >> ~/.hermes/.env

六、启动协同AI开发团队

配置完成后,在终端启动Hermes Agent:

hermes

输入以下协同指令,确立双AI工作模式:

请你协同Claude Code来帮助我完成代码开发任务,你作为主协调者,Claude Code负责编码。
我会给你下发开发任务,你或者Claude Code给出设计方案后必须由我确定后再开始实际开发。

至此,AI开发团队正式启动,随时可以接收开发任务。

七、实战示例:小游戏自动生成

用户可直接下达需求,例如:

帮我开发一个网页版黄金矿工小游戏,使用Canvas渲染,包含关卡、计分、倒计时逻辑。

Hermes会先输出设计方案,确认后安排Claude Code进行代码开发,最终输出完整可运行的HTML、CSS、JS项目文件,用户可直接在浏览器预览效果。

整个过程无需人工干预编码细节,只需把控方案与最终效果。

八、协同模式的核心优势

1. 分工明确,效率更高

Hermes专注规划、调度、记忆;Claude Code专注编码、实现、调试,各司其职。

2. 方案可控,风险更低

所有开发必须经过用户确认,避免AI盲目执行。

3. 持续进化,越用越强

每次任务都会沉淀经验,后续任务速度更快、质量更高。

4. 环境一键搭建,门槛极低

依托阿里云DevBox,无需配置环境、安装依赖、处理版本冲突。

5. 云端运行,随时随地可用

基于云服务器,可远程连接开发,不占用本地设备资源。

九、总结

Hermes Agent与Claude Code的组合,构建了新一代AI驱动的协同开发模式。主控智能体负责统筹管理、记忆进化,编码专家负责高质量实现,搭配云端一键部署能力,让个人与团队能够以最低成本拥有一支全天候、可成长、高效率的AI开发团队。

从简单脚本到完整项目,从界面开发到逻辑实现,这套架构均可稳定支撑。对于追求效率、希望减少重复编码工作、快速落地创意的开发者而言,这是目前最成熟、最实用的AI开发方案之一。

目录
相关文章
|
23天前
|
弹性计算 人工智能 机器人
超详细!Hermes Agent 一键部署全流程指南,轻松上手不踩坑
本文将为大家分享 Hermes Agent 一键部署全流程指南,助力大家轻松上手不踩坑!
2266 17
|
22小时前
|
人工智能 数据可视化 网络安全
阿里云/本地一键部署OpenClaw(Clawdbot)教程
OpenClaw(原Clawdbot)作为轻量级AI自动化代理工具,2026年版本在部署灵活性上实现重大升级,既支持本地私有化部署(满足数据隐私、内网使用需求),也适配阿里云一键部署方案(兼顾便捷性与云端稳定性)。本文将完整拆解两种部署方式的核心流程,从环境准备、安装配置到功能验证,包含实操代码命令与避坑技巧,无论你是需要本地私有化部署的企业用户,还是追求零门槛的个人用户,都能快速完成OpenClaw的落地使用。
77 1
|
2月前
|
存储 人工智能 监控
OpenClaw到底是什么?普通人能用它干嘛?
OpenClaw是一款开源AI智能体,以红色龙虾为标识,主打“真正能做事”——理解指令、自主拆解任务、调用软件执行。支持文件整理、邮件处理、报告生成、日程管理、抢购监控、夜间爬取等六大实用场景,可本地或云端部署,兼顾高效与隐私安全。
5077 5
|
15小时前
|
人工智能 BI 持续交付
Claude Code 深度适配 DeepSeek V4-Pro 实测:全场景通关与真实体验报告
在 AI 编程工具日趋主流的今天,Claude Code 凭借强大的任务执行、工具调用与工程化能力,成为开发者与自动化运维的核心效率工具。但随着原生模型账号稳定性问题频发,寻找一套兼容、稳定、能力在线的替代方案变得尤为重要。DeepSeek V4-Pro 作为新一代高性能大模型,提供了完整兼容 Claude 协议的 API 接口,只需简单配置即可无缝驱动 Claude Code,且在任务执行、工具调用、复杂流程处理上表现极为稳定。
108 0
|
19天前
|
存储 JSON Linux
在线CAD开发包图纸转换功能使用指南-WEB端CAD
MxDraw云图开发包提供跨平台图纸格式转换功能,支持DWG/DXF/MXWEB/PDF/JPG互转及范围裁剪。含命令行直调与1337端口HTTP接口两种方式,适配Windows/Linux(x86_64/ARM),需下载对应版本并配置权限。
在线CAD开发包图纸转换功能使用指南-WEB端CAD
|
2天前
|
人工智能 Serverless API
托管 Agent 执行循环只是起点,AgentRun 托管的更是企业 AI 生产全链路
本文对比分析函数计算 AgentRun 与 Claude Managed Agents 架构:二者均以 Agent/Environment/Session/Events 为核心,但 AgentRun 在模型自由、VPC 数据不出域、多语言代码解释器、浏览器自动化、统一凭证管理及 OpenTelemetry 可观测性等方面更具企业级优势。
|
16小时前
|
人工智能 监控 测试技术
Claude Code、OpenClaw、Cursor 全方位对比:AI 工具如何适配真实开发与测试场景
在 AI 开发工具快速迭代的当下,Claude Code、OpenClaw、Cursor 三类工具频繁出现在开发者与测试工程师的视野中。很多人会困惑:这三款工具到底谁更实用、该学习哪一个、能否互相替代。事实上,三者并非竞争替代关系,而是面向不同场景、不同工作流的分层协作工具。Claude Code 专注于终端环境下的高推理自动化与 CI/CD 闭环,Cursor 深耕 IDE 内部编码提效,OpenClaw 则主打 24 小时无人值守、消息驱动的长期自动化任务。本文从定位、底层机制、Skill 扩展、测试场景适配、工程落地等角度完整拆解,帮助团队与个人科学选型、分步落地。
53 1
|
3天前
|
人工智能 弹性计算 IDE
使用Hermes Agent与Claude Code构建AI开发团队
阿里云推出Hermes Agent×Claude Code协同开发方案:Hermes作为智能主控,负责需求分析、任务拆解与经验沉淀;Claude Code专注高质量编码执行。二者构建“技术主管+资深工程师”式AI团队,支持一键部署于DevBox,实现战略规划与战术执行闭环。